Broker Relations Representative jobs in Mandan, ND

Broker Relations Representative establishes or maintains a business relationship with new or existing brokers. Provides commissions for brokers in an accurate and timely manner. Being a Broker Relations Representative troubleshoots all the administrative and specialized issues from brokers and clients. Handles concerns, issues and questions from brokers and customers. Additionally, Broker Relations Representative requ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Broker Relations Representative g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. To be a Broker Relations Representative typ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Arrow Service Team started as a small carpet cleaning company in 1979. Over the years, we have grown to over 65 employees and have expanded our services to include fire & water damage restoration, mold removal, trauma, and emergency board-ups. We also continue to clean residential and commercial carpets and HVAC and ductwork. Core family values make Arrow Service Team grow year after year. We pride ourselves in being a local family-owned company. We have a fully trained in-house team of disaster restoration specialists, including water mitigation techs, fire restoration techs, finish carpenters, flooring installers, painters, and carpet and HVAC technicians. Mandan is a city on the eastern border of Morton County and is the seventh-largest city in North Dakota. Founded in 1879 on the west side of the upper Missouri River, it was designated in 1881 as the county seat of Morton County. The U.S. Census Bureau estimated the 2017 population at 22,228. Located across the Missouri River from the state capital of Bismarck, Mandan is a core city of the Bismarck-Mandan Metropolitan Statistical Area.
